Fix .travis.yml for updated OSX image

Since [1], OSX builds on travis fail with:

Error: Refusing to uninstall /usr/local/Cellar/python/3.6.5_1
because it is required by gdal, numpy, postgis, which are currently installed.

Revise #3163
